13.4.3 Panel for the Sampler
For the Sampler, the Plug-in Strip provides a custom panel containing a judicious mix of pa-
rameters available in the three first pages of the Control area along with parameters available
in the
Zone
page of the Sample Editor.
As with all other Plug-ins, the panel for the Sampler shows the Plug-in Header at the top. This
Header contains the name of the current preset and the Quick Browse icon — see section
above for more details.
The Sampler panel contains two distinct panes:
MAIN
and
ZONE
. These can be displayed by
clicking the
MAIN
and
ZONE
button in the Pane selector at the top of the Sampler interface,
respectively.
